## Step 4: Migrate the Proctoring Queue — Examguard

This step moves exam-session events from the legacy queue to the new encrypted broker. Messages are signed at enqueue time and verified by the consumer before any proctoring decision is recorded; unsigned messages are quarantined. Dead-letter handling is unchanged. No plaintext candidate identifiers transit the new queue. For your review, the broker configuration applied during this step is reproduced below.

settings of bafof-fajog:
[aldix]
port = 9300
region = north-3
host = aldix.kelvilabs.example
team = istath
timeout_ms = 1500
retries = 8

Quarterly Planning Note — Farrow Street Lease

For the incoming director: the Farrow Street lease expires in ten months. Landlord has signalled openness to a five-year renewal at a reduced rate if we commit early. Facilities has costed a relocation alternative; it's marginally cheaper but disruptive. Our negotiating position is summarised below.

management briefing: The renewal with Zoraelax Group closes at $10 million a year, 15 percent below the last contract. Project Ralael slips by six weeks because of the audit delay.

## Service Accounts: orm-refactor-bot

Quick note for reviewers poking at the Thistlebay ORM refactor: the `orm-refactor-bot` account runs our schema-diff checks against the legacy Mudgate mapping layer, so expect its comments on any PR touching entity classes. It's read-only against staging and can't merge anything, promise. If you need to run the diff tool locally, the key it authenticates with is below.

API key for tagef-fafop: vxb2-ta